My senior dog is suddenly anxious, panting, restless, and hiding. Why?

Updated On September 23rd, 2025

Pet's info: Dog | Lhasa Apso | Male | neutered | 15 years and 1 month old | 19 lbs

My dog is having high anxiety, restlessness, panting and jumping as if scared. He is hinging under desk or vanity where I am sitting. He is 19 lbs and 15 years old.

Poor Gibson! As dogs age, they can develop canine cognitive dysfunction (similar to dementia in humans) or decreases in their hearing and sight, which can result in anxiety and behavioral changes. Restlessness, panting and sudden jumping could also be a sign of pain. At this point, your best bet is to take Gibson to his vet for evaluation to determine if he has any apparent sources of pain, which could be managed with pain medication. If not, your vet will be able to discuss some of the different medication options to try to manage cognitive dysfunction, but these are not always overly effective. I hope that all goes well!
